ABSOLUTE MAXIMUM RATINGS
Power Supply Range
Voltage at Any Pin
Operating Temperature
Storage Temperature
Package Dissipation
7 Volts
GND-0.3 V to VCC+0.3 V
-40o to +85oC
-65o to +150oC
500 mW
TYPICAL PACKAGE THERMAL RESISTANCE DATA (MARGIN OF ERROR: ± 15%)
Thermal Resistance (48-TQFP)
theta-ja =59oC/W, theta-jc = 16oC/W
Thermal Resistance (44-PLCC)
Thermal Resistance (40-PDIP)
theta-ja = 50oC/W, theta-jc = 21oC/W
theta-ja = 50oC/W, theta-jc = 22oC/W
